What Exactly is a Head Spa Treatment?
Unlike your typical salon experience, a head spa treatment isn’t just about making your hair look goodâit’s about healing from within. These therapeutic sessions typically include a thorough scalp analysis, deep cleansing treatments, rejuvenating massages, and customized care that addresses specific concerns like tension, buildup, or thinning hair.
“A head spa is essentially a facial for your scalp,” explains one Toronto head spa specialist. “We’re treating the foundation of hair health while simultaneously providing a deeply relaxing experience that benefits your entire body.”
A typical session might include:
- Detailed scalp analysis using specialized equipment
- Gentle exfoliation to remove product buildup and dead skin cells
- Deep cleansing with customized products
- Therapeutic massage using pressure points to release tension
- Specialized treatments using steam, micro mist, or LED therapy
- Moisturizing and nourishing treatments
The result? A healthier scalp, improved hair quality, and a profound sense of relaxation that many clients describe as “transformative.”

The Science-Backed Benefits of Head Spa Treatments
The growing popularity of head spa treatments isn’t just about following trendsâthere’s substantial evidence supporting their benefits:
Physical Benefits
Head spa treatments offer remarkable physical advantages beyond just improving hair appearance. Regular sessions can significantly enhance blood circulation to the scalp, which is essential for delivering nutrients to hair follicles and promoting healthier growth. This increased blood flow can also help strengthen hair strands from the root, potentially reducing issues like breakage and thinning.
The detoxifying nature of these treatments effectively removes product buildup, excess oil, and environmental pollutants that can clog follicles and impede hair health. By thoroughly cleansing the scalp at a deeper level than regular shampooing can achieve, head spas create an optimal environment for hair growth.
For those struggling with specific scalp conditions like dandruff or excessive dryness, specialized head spa protocols can provide targeted relief through customized treatments that address the root causes rather than just masking symptoms.
Mental and Emotional Benefits
Perhaps even more impressive than the physical benefits are the mental and emotional advantages of head spa therapy. The scalp contains numerous nerve endings and pressure points connected to various bodily systems. When these points are stimulated during a therapeutic scalp massage, it can trigger the release of tension throughout the entire body.
Many clients report significant stress reduction following their sessions, with the calming effects often lasting for days. This stress relief isn’t just subjectiveâstudies have shown that scalp massage can lower cortisol levels and stimulate the parasympathetic nervous system, which controls the body’s rest and digest functions.
For those dealing with tension headaches or migraines, regular head spa treatments may offer welcome relief. The combination of pressure point therapy and improved circulation can help reduce the frequency and intensity of head pain for many sufferers.

Incorporating Head Spa Principles at Home
While professional treatments provide the most comprehensive benefits, you can extend their effects by incorporating some head spa principles into your at-home routine:
- Daily gentle massage: Spend 5-10 minutes each day massaging your scalp with your fingertips in circular motions
- Weekly exfoliation: Use a gentle scalp scrub once a week to remove buildup
- Proper hydration: Ensure your scalp stays moisturized with appropriate products for your hair type
- Mindful product selection: Choose hair care products free from harsh chemicals that can disrupt scalp health
- Balanced diet: Consume foods rich in omega-3s, biotin, and other nutrients that support hair health
These simple practices can help maintain the benefits of professional treatments and promote ongoing scalp wellness between visits.
